Công cụ chẩn đoán lỗi máy tính bị treo
Nhập thông tin về tình trạng máy tính của bạn để nhận giải pháp khắc phục tối ưu
Kết quả chẩn đoán
Hướng dẫn toàn diện: Cách khắc phục lỗi máy tính bị treo (2024)
Máy tính bị treo là một trong những vấn đề phổ biến và gây khó chịu nhất mà người dùng gặp phải. Khi máy tính đột ngột ngừng phản hồi, không chỉ công việc bị gián đoạn mà còn có thể dẫn đến mất dữ liệu quan trọng. Trong hướng dẫn chi tiết này, chúng tôi sẽ phân tích nguyên nhân gốc rễ, cung cấp giải pháp từng bước và chia sẻ mẹo phòng ngừa để giúp bạn xử lý tình huống này một cách chuyên nghiệp.
1. Nguyên nhân phổ biến gây treo máy tính
Theo nghiên cứu từ Viện Tiêu chuẩn và Công nghệ Quốc gia (NIST), có 7 nguyên nhân chính gây treo máy tính, chiếm 92% các trường hợp:
- Xung đột phần mềm (35%): Hai hoặc nhiều chương trình cố gắng sử dụng cùng một tài nguyên hệ thống.
- Quá tải bộ nhớ (22%): RAM không đủ để xử lý các tác vụ đang chạy.
- Lỗi driver (18%): Driver phần cứng không tương thích hoặc bị hỏng.
- Quá nhiệt (12%): CPU hoặc GPU vượt quá nhiệt độ an toàn.
- Lỗi ổ cứng (7%): Bad sector hoặc ổ cứng sắp hỏng.
- Virus/malware (4%): Phần mềm độc hại chiếm dụng tài nguyên.
- Lỗi hệ điều hành (2%): File hệ thống bị hỏng hoặc cập nhật lỗi.
| Nguyên nhân | Tần suất | Mức độ nghiêm trọng | Chi phí sửa chữa ước tính |
|---|---|---|---|
| Xung đột phần mềm | 35% | Thấp | 0đ (tự sửa) |
| Quá tải bộ nhớ | 22% | Trung bình | 1.500.000đ – 4.000.000đ (nâng cấp RAM) |
| Lỗi driver | 18% | Thấp-Trung bình | 0đ – 1.000.000đ |
| Quá nhiệt | 12% | Cao | 500.000đ – 3.000.000đ (làm sạch/vệ sinh) |
| Lỗi ổ cứng | 7% | Rất cao | 2.000.000đ – 10.000.000đ (thay ổ cứng) |
2. Cách khắc phục lỗi máy tính bị treo theo từng bước
Bước 1: Xử lý ngay khi máy tính bị treo
- Kiên nhẫn chờ đợi: Đôi khi hệ thống chỉ tạm thời bị quá tải. Chờ 2-3 phút trước khi hành động.
- Sử dụng Task Manager:
- Nhấn Ctrl + Shift + Esc để mở Task Manager
- Tìm chương trình đang chiếm nhiều CPU/Bộ nhớ
- Chọn chương trình → End Task
- Khởi động lại cứng:
- Nhấn giữ nút nguồn 5-10 giây để tắt máy
- Chờ 30 giây trước khi bật lại
- Lặp lại 2-3 lần nếu cần (giúp reset bộ nhớ)
Bước 2: Chẩn đoán nguyên nhân gốc rễ
Sau khi máy tính hoạt động trở lại, thực hiện các bước sau để xác định nguyên nhân:
| Công cụ chẩn đoán | Cách sử dụng | Đối tượng kiểm tra |
|---|---|---|
| Event Viewer | Nhấn Win + X → Event Viewer → Windows Logs → System | Lỗi hệ thống, driver |
| Resource Monitor | Nhấn Win + R → gõ resmon → Enter | Sử dụng CPU, RAM, Disk, Network |
| Task Manager | Ctrl + Shift + Esc → Performance tab | Tài nguyên hệ thống thời gian thực |
| CrystalDiskInfo | Tải về từ crystalmark.info | Sức khỏe ổ cứng |
| MemTest86 | Tạo USB boot từ memtest86.com | Lỗi bộ nhớ RAM |
Bước 3: Giải pháp khắc phục cụ thể
A. Xung đột phần mềm:
- Gỡ cài đặt phần mềm gần đây: Control Panel → Programs → Uninstall
- Vô hiệu hóa phần mềm khởi động cùng hệ thống:
- Task Manager → Startup tab
- Chọn chương trình → Disable
- Chạy hệ thống ở Safe Mode để kiểm tra:
- Khởi động lại → nhấn F8 (hoặc Shift + Restart → Troubleshoot)
- Chọn Safe Mode with Networking
B. Quá tải bộ nhớ:
- Nâng cấp RAM:
- Kiểm tra loại RAM tương thích: CPU-Z → SPD tab
- Mua RAM cùng loại và tốc độ bus
- Lắp đặt đúng khe (tham khảo hướng dẫn mainboard)
- Tối ưu hóa sử dụng bộ nhớ:
- Đặt Virtual Memory: 1.5x-3x dung lượng RAM vật lý
- Vô hiệu hóa hiệu ứng hình ảnh: System → Advanced → Performance Settings
C. Lỗi driver:
- Cập nhật driver:
- Device Manager → chọn thiết bị → Update driver
- Tải driver chính hãng từ website nhà sản xuất
- Rollback driver (nếu lỗi sau cập nhật):
- Device Manager → Properties → Driver tab → Roll Back Driver
- Sử dụng công cụ tự động:
3. Giải pháp nâng cao cho kỹ thuật viên
Đối với các trường hợp phức tạp, bạn có thể cần áp dụng các kỹ thuật sau:
A. Kiểm tra phần cứng chuyên sâu:
- Test RAM:
- Sử dụng MemTest86 (chạy ít nhất 4 pass)
- Tháo lắp lại RAM, vệ sinh chân tiếp xúc bằng tẩy chì
- Kiểm tra ổ cứng:
- Chạy chkdsk /f /r trong Command Prompt (Admin)
- Sử dụng HD Tune để quét bad sector
- Kiểm tra nguồn:
- Đo điện áp bằng đồng hồ vạn năng (12V, 5V, 3.3V)
- Thay thử nguồn khác nếu nghi ngờ
B. Phân tích dump file:
- Cấu hình hệ thống tạo dump file:
- System → Advanced → Startup and Recovery → Settings
- Chọn Complete memory dump hoặc Kernel memory dump
- Phân tích bằng WinDbg hoặc BlueScreenView
- Tìm kiếm mã lỗi trên Microsoft Docs
C. Sửa chữa hệ điều hành:
- Sử dụng DISM và SFC:
DISM /Online /Cleanup-Image /RestoreHealth SFC /scannow
- Reset Windows (giữ lại file cá nhân):
- Settings → Update & Security → Recovery → Reset this PC
- Cài đặt lại Windows sạch:
- Tạo USB boot bằng Media Creation Tool
- Format ổ đĩa và cài mới hoàn toàn
4. Phòng ngừa lỗi máy tính bị treo
Áp dụng các biện pháp sau để giảm thiểu nguy cơ máy tính bị treo:
- Bảo trì phần cứng định kỳ:
- Vệ sinh bụi bẩn mỗi 3-6 tháng
- Thay keo tản nhiệt cho CPU/GPU mỗi 2 năm
- Kiểm tra quạt tản nhiệt hoạt động bình thường
- Quản lý phần mềm:
- Gỡ cài đặt phần mềm không sử dụng
- Cập nhật hệ điều hành và driver định kỳ
- Sử dụng phần mềm diệt virus uy tín (Windows Defender, Bitdefender)
- Tối ưu hóa hệ thống:
- Chạy Disk Cleanup hàng tháng
- Chống phân mảnh ổ đĩa (đối với HDD)
- Vô hiệu hóa các dịch vụ không cần thiết: msconfig → Services
- Sao lưu dữ liệu:
- Sử dụng 3-2-1 Backup Rule (3 bản sao, 2 phương tiện, 1 bản ngoài site)
- Công cụ đề xuất: Macrium Reflect, Veeam Agent
5. Khi nào nên mang máy tính đến trung tâm sửa chữa?
Mặc dù nhiều vấn đề có thể tự khắc phục tại nhà, bạn nên cân nhắc đưa máy đến trung tâm sửa chữa chuyên nghiệp trong các trường hợp sau:
- Máy tính bị treo kèm theo mùi khét (có thể do chập điện)
- Ổ cứng phát ra tiếng kêu lạch cạch liên tục
- Đã thử tất cả giải pháp phần mềm nhưng vẫn bị treo thường xuyên
- Máy tính không thể khởi động vào được hệ điều hành
- Cần thay thế linh kiện phần cứng (RAM, ổ cứng, mainboard)
- Máy tính còn bảo hành (tránh tự sửa làm mất bảo hành)
Khi lựa chọn trung tâm sửa chữa, hãy:
- Chọn cơ sở có chứng nhận từ hãng (đối với máy còn bảo hành)
- Yêu cầu báo giá chi tiết trước khi sửa chữa
- Kiểm tra phản hồi từ khách hàng trên Google Maps/Facebook
- Yêu cầu bảo hành sau sửa chữa (ít nhất 1-3 tháng)
6. Các câu hỏi thường gặp về lỗi máy tính bị treo
Câu hỏi 1: Máy tính bị treo khi chơi game phải làm sao?
Trả lời: Đây thường là do:
- Quá nhiệt GPU/CPU: Kiểm tra nhiệt độ bằng HWMonitor, vệ sinh quạt tản nhiệt
- Driver đồ họa lỗi thời: Cập nhật driver mới nhất từ NVIDIA/AMD/Intel
- Cấu hình game quá cao: Giảm thiết lập đồ họa, vô hiệu hóa anti-aliasing
- Nguồn không đủ công suất: Kiểm tra PSU có đủ watt cho card đồ họa
Câu hỏi 2: Máy tính bị treo khi khởi động có phải ổ cứng hỏng?
Trả lời: Không phải luôn luôn. Nguyên nhân có thể bao gồm:
- File hệ thống bị hỏng (chạy sfc /scannow)
- Xung đột phần mềm khởi động (vào Safe Mode để kiểm tra)
- Lỗi phân vùng ổ đĩa (sử dụng TestDisk)
- Hỏng ổ cứng (kiểm tra bằng CrystalDiskInfo)
Nếu ổ cứng báo “Caution” hoặc “Bad” trong CrystalDiskInfo, bạn nên sao lưu dữ liệu và thay ổ mới.
Câu hỏi 3: Có nên tự thay keo tản nhiệt không?
Trả lời:
- Nên: Nếu bạn có kinh nghiệm và công cụ phù hợp (keo tản nhiệt chất lượng, tua vít chính xác)
- Không nên: Nếu đây là lần đầu tiên hoặc máy còn bảo hành
- Lưu ý:
- Sử dụng keo tản nhiệt chất lượng (Arctic MX-4, Noctua NT-H1)
- Làm sạch bề mặt tản nhiệt bằng cồn isopropyl 90%+
- Bôi lượng keo vừa phải (kích thước hạt đậu)
Câu hỏi 4: Làm sao biết máy tính bị treo do virus?
Trả lời: Dấu hiệu máy tính bị treo do virus:
- Task Manager显示 có tiến trình lạ chiếm dụng CPU/Bộ nhớ cao
- Máy tính bị treo kèm hiện quảng cáo hoặc popup lạ
- Tốc độ mạng chậm bất thường (virus đang gửi dữ liệu)
- File hệ thống bị修改 ngày giờ gần đây mà bạn không hành động
- Phần mềm diệt virus bị vô hiệu hóa không rõ nguyên nhân
Giải pháp:
- Ngắt kết nối internet
- Khởi động vào Safe Mode with Networking
- Sử dụng Malwarebytes hoặc HitmanPro quét toàn hệ thống
- Nếu không thể loại bỏ, nên cài lại Windows
7. Công cụ hỗ trợ khắc phục lỗi máy tính bị treo
| Công cụ | Mô tả | Link tải | Mức độ |
|---|---|---|---|
| BlueScreenView | Phân tích file dump khi máy bị treo màn hình xanh | nirsoft.net | Nâng cao |
| WhoCrashed | Xác định driver gây ra lỗi hệ thống | resplendence.com | Trung bình |
| Process Explorer | Phiên bản nâng cao của Task Manager | Microsoft Sysinternals | Nâng cao |
| CrystalDiskInfo | Kiểm tra sức khỏe ổ cứng/SSD | crystalmark.info | Cơ bản |
| MemTest86 | Kiểm tra lỗi bộ nhớ RAM | memtest86.com | Nâng cao |
| HWMonitor | Theo dõi nhiệt độ, điện áp, tốc độ quạt | cpuid.com | Cơ bản |
8. Kết luận và khuyến nghị
Lỗi máy tính bị treo có thể xuất phát từ nhiều nguyên nhân khác nhau, từ đơn giản đến phức tạp. Quá trình khắc phục đòi hỏi sự kiên nhẫn và phương pháp tiếp cận có hệ thống:
- Bước 1: Xác định triệu chứng cụ thể (khi nào, như thế nào máy bị treo)
- Bước 2: Loại trừ từng nguyên nhân từ đơn giản đến phức tạp
- Bước 3: Áp dụng giải pháp phù hợp với nguyên nhân đã xác định
- Bước 4: Thực hiện các biện pháp phòng ngừa để tránh tái phát
Đối với người dùng không có kinh nghiệm kỹ thuật, chúng tôi khuyên bạn:
- Bắt đầu với các giải pháp đơn giản như khởi động lại máy, chạy phần mềm diệt virus
- Sao lưu dữ liệu quan trọng trước khi thực hiện bất kỳ thay đổi hệ thống nào
- Ghi chép lại các bước đã thử và kết quả để cung cấp thông tin cho kỹ thuật viên nếu cần
- Không ngần ngại tìm kiếm sự trợ giúp chuyên nghiệp nếu vấn đề vượt quá khả năng của bạn
Hy vọng hướng dẫn này đã cung cấp cho bạn kiến thức toàn diện để chẩn đoán, khắc phục và phòng ngừa lỗi máy tính bị treo. Nếu bạn có bất kỳ câu hỏi hoặc tình huống cụ thể nào, đừng ngần ngại để lại bình luận bên dưới – chúng tôi sẽ cố gắng hỗ trợ bạn trong thời gian sớm nhất!
Tham khảo thêm:
- Trung tâm hỗ trợ Microsoft – Hướng dẫn chính thức về lỗi hệ thống
- US-CERT – Cập nhật bảo mật và lỗi phần mềm
- Khóa học về máy tính từ Khan Academy – Kiến thức nền tảng về phần cứng